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0977 536619 094 06037393
3732 1069952
3732 1069952
54 4255 52923 30327
All about undefined
Interested in learning more?
3732 1069952
54 4255 52923 30327
See more
193505 7309 151050
106074 30 0381948131 3022163640
See more
06 19573213
1202876212 154141 31206536537
See more